Target Background

Function
NAD-dependent histone deacetylase involved in telomeric silencing. Histone deacetylase proteins act via the formation of large multiprotein complexes that are responsible for the deacetylation of lysine residues on the N-terminal part of the core histones (H2A, H2B, H3 and H4). Histone deacetylation gives a tag for epigenetic repression and plays an important role in transcriptional regulation, cell cycle progression and developmental events. Restores silencing at HMR in SIR2 mutants when overexpressed. Required to repress middle sporulation genes during vegetative growth. Acts as a sensor of NAD(+) levels and regulator of NAD(+) biosynthesis. Regulates the gene expression of de novo NAD(+) biosynthesis genes.
Gene References into Functions
  1. study demonstrates that Hst1, the closest Sir2 paralogue, deacetylates the acetylated lysine 16 of histone H4 (H4K16Ac) and represses PMA1 transcription in the sir2Delta pde2Delta mutant. Collectively,results suggest that Hst1 can substitute for Sir2 by deacetylating H4K16Ac only in the sir2Delta pde2Delta PMID: 28120189
  2. Crystals of HST1 grown by the hanging-drop vapour-diffusion method diffracted to 2.90 A resolution and belonged to space group P2(1), with unit-cell parameters a = 40.2, b = 101.7, c = 43.9 A, beta = 103.9 degrees PMID: 22139171
  3. Data show that multiple thiamine (THI) genes in Saccharomyces cerevisiae are also regulated by the intracellular NAD(+) concentration via the NAD(+)-dependent histone deacetylase (HDAC) Hst1 and, to a lesser extent, Sir2. PMID: 20439498
  4. Sir2p and Hst1p are paralogs with non-overlapping functions that can provide genetic robustness against null mutations through a substitution mechanism. PMID: 17676954
  5. The results of this study suggest recruitment of the Sum1/Rfm1/Hst1 complex to a number of yeast origins, where Hst1 deacetylated H4 K5. PMID: 18990212
